  1. What is the percent by volume of vinegar in a sulotion that contain 3.0 ml of acetic acid dissolved in 50.5 ml water

Solution:

solute = acetic acid (3.0 mL)

solvent = water (50.5 mL)

volume of solution = volume of solute + volume of solvent = 3.0 mL + 50.5 mL = 53.5 mL


Percent concentration by volume, (v/v)%:

(v/v)% = (volume of solute / volume of solution) × 100%

Hence,

(v/v)% = (3.0 mL / 53.5 mL) × 100% = 5.6075% = 5.6%

(v/v)% = 5.6% acetic acid


Answer: The percent by volume of vinegar is 5.6%.
